Helldivers 2 gamers have spent their time within the galaxy since launch studying how you can work collectively for a typical trigger. When the Automatons mysteriously returned to menace the galaxy, tacticians would take to X and Discord to encourage followers to hit the proper planets. Tremendous Earth requested Helldivers to kill two billion bugs, and the participant base pulled it off within hours. However the greatest coordinated effort that gamers have pulled off shouldn’t be in opposition to the bugs or bots, however in opposition to the sport’s writer, Sony — and after a weekend of protest, the Helldivers scored a large triumph.
On Friday, Sony introduced that Helldivers 2 gamers would want to hyperlink their in-game accounts to their Sony accounts, requiring a log-in to an extra platform. It was a tremendously unpopular change, and Steam gamers have been vocal about their displeasure. Whereas some gamers have been merely aggravated at an additional step of pink tape, or petrified of storing their info on Sony’s servers after earlier knowledge leaks, others have been locked out totally. The PlayStation Community is not accessible in 177 countries and territories, and so gamers from areas just like the Philippines fully misplaced entry to a recreation they’d already paid for.
Helldivers 2 gamers instantly moved into motion, coordinating on platforms like Reddit, X, and Discord to make their displeasure clear. Helldivers 2 was hit with hundreds of thousands of negative Steam reviews, turning its very optimistic rating the wrong way up. Gamers made memes and propaganda posters, rallying underneath the slogan “We dive collectively, or we don’t dive.” Neighborhood members discovered that Steam would situation refunds, even for accounts that had gone nicely past the 2 hours, and inspired fellow followers to refund en masse. Not even the primary Helldivers was off limits, because the circa 2015 title was likewise ruthlessly review-bombed.
The infrastructure for this form of effort had already been established by Helldivers 2’s Main Orders, which generally final round per week, and ask the gamers to realize an goal. That may be one thing like holding a defensive position, conquering a sequence of planets, or organising infrastructure. Devoted gamers will name out priorities on social media to much less centered followers, encouraging everybody to dogpile on a single planet with the intention to advance the Main Order, or calling individuals again from an unwinnable entrance.
As one staffer at Arrowhead Game Studios put it, “I do have to present it to the group, ya’ll fuckers are good at working collectively for a significant frequent objective.”
Positive sufficient, Sony caved on Sunday night time, asserting that the sport would now not require account linking. Followers, in flip, have began to take away among the harm their preliminary protest brought about — they usually’re utilizing Helldivers 2’s kayfabe with the intention to make these requests. The Helldivers subreddit has a pinned post, marked as a Major Order, which reads:
“Sony has reversed their resolution to maneuver ahead with the account linking replace. Helldivers; do you have to select to just accept this main order. Please think about reversing your steam evaluate. Arrowhead has labored very onerous to make this recreation particular, and also you the participant have proven each Sony and Arrowhead that your voice issues too. Allow us to restore Helldivers 2 on steam again to it’s formal [sic] glory. And allow us to restore this group again to regular. Please reverse any unfavourable critiques you left for another video games that Arrowhead or Sony has labored on. Lets [sic] do higher as a group and never do this once more.”
The Helldivers 2 fanbase are having fun with their victory, with one fan even creating physical merch of Helldiver-themed patches celebrating success against Sony. Arrowhead has created a recreation that requires its participant base to speak, work collectively, and juggle priorities. This newest snafu with Sony reveals that followers have realized this lesson nicely, they usually’re in a position to take these expertise outdoors of the warfare desk and apply it to the true world. Whereas many followers inspired protestors to give attention to Sony, and go away Arrowhead out of the crossfire, others have been much less discriminating with their anger. It stays to be seen whether or not this pattern finally ends up being a power for optimistic change, or whether or not this motivated fanbase will proceed to campaign over common hiccups that are inclined to happen in any reside service recreation. For now, most gamers appear content material with this large overcome Sony — and happy with the group that scored such an enormous win.
